This Kiddo Active Life Skills Group is designed to provide an opportunity for pre-teens to engage in fun activities with similar aged peers while developing social skills, executive functioning skill and specific life skills. We will slowly build on the skills that are practiced throughout adolescence. The group will be led by an occupational therapist who designs and modifies every activity for each participants ability, needs and goals so that everyone experiences success and goal achievement. The group will decide on an outing they would like to do at the end of the 6 weeks, and each week they will engage in learning activities towards planning that activity.
These are some of the skills that will be introduced and practiced this summer:
How to make a group plan that can accommodate the needs of and interests of the group.
How to plan for and get to and from activities using public transportation when supervised.
How to research on the internet or by phone call in order to find, plan and execute the group activity.
Introduction on how to use smart phone apps for good – time management, planning, organizing, communicating with parents and friends, etc.
Phone etiquette – communication with the group as well as reaching out in the community through text and voice.
Planning and organizing as part of a group – including leadership and active participation in the group.
Important hygiene and personal management topics will be covered as they pertain to the group and the planned activities.
Budgeting and money management.
